NFL News: The Green Bay Packers may have one of the best kick-off returners in the entire NFL. Keisean Nixon came on in a big way for the Packers in 2023. The Packers’ special teams unit has been a disappointment over the years, but Nixon became a beam of light in a dark room. He took over kick-returning duties in week 8 and never looked back. He had 1,009 kick return yards, including a 105-yard touchdown against the Vikings. Going into the 2023 season, Nixon has some pretty high expectations.
Green Bay Packers Kick Returner Keisean Nixon Makes Emphatic Statement About The 2023 Season
Keisean Nixon may expand his role in 2023. He will likely spend time playing nickel, which will also allow Rasul Douglas to move back outside, where he recorded five interceptions back in 2021. The eventual return of Eric Stokes will also give the team a big boost on the outside and it’s looking like he could return as soon as camp starts. And, of course, there’s Jaire Alexander, the team’s lockdown corner, in the mix. Given all these factors, Nixon said the Green Bay Packers CB room could be the best in the league:
“We want to be the best and we’re going to show that,” Nixon recently told reporters. “I feel like we have the room and the corners to do it. Especially when [Eric] Stokes gets back.
“It’s going to be big. Y’all are going to see.”
With all the changes to the Packers’ offense, relying on a stout defense will be a “must” in 2023. Jordan Love, Christian Watson, Romeo Doubs, Samori Toure, Jayden Reed, Luke Musgrave, Tucker Kraft, Aaron Jones, and AJ Dillon make up an extremely young, but talented group. Many are optimistic about what this offense can do together, however, no one knows how long it will take them to get clicking.
Over the last five games of the season the Green Bay Packers’ defense allowed 17 points per game. If they can continue that trend into the 2023 season, it will give the offense time to get their groove. Special Teams and Defense will play a larger role than ever for the Green Bay Packers’ success in 2023.
